ATP Doha: Impressed Jiri Lehecka ousts Carlos Alcaraz

World no. 25 Jiri Lehecka notched his career-best victory on the ATP 500 occasion in Doha. The Czech confronted world no.3 Carlos Alcaraz within the quarter-final and earned a 6-3, 3-6, 6-4 victory in two hours and 9 minutes.

The highest seed managed the scoreboard, taking the second set and constructing a 4-2 benefit within the decider. Jiri refused to surrender, rattling off the ultimate 4 video games and rising on the high. Lehecka will face Jack Draper within the semi-final.

The Spaniard claimed 4 factors greater than the Czech. Each gamers struggled behind the second serve and battled towards 15 break probabilities. Jiri saved 4 of seven and transformed 4 of eight alternatives, together with back-to-back breaks within the closing phases of the duel.

By official stats, Carlos landed 32 winners and 25 unforced errors, whereas his rival embraced 18 direct factors and 36 errors. If that is true, Jiri needed to drive quite a few errors from his opponent to erase that deficit. The Czech hit seven service winners extra whereas struggling from the baseline.
